Adelaide toddler’s only hope — $850000 gene therapy
The Advertiser
The only known treatment for her condition depends on a unique gene therapy trial due to start in the next 12-18 months in Philadelphia. It follows the success of a similar trial in children with mutations of the RPE65 gene using a one-off treatment

Researchers shed new light on identity of brain stem cells
News-Medical.net
The human nervous system is a complex structure that sends electrical signals from the brain to the rest of the body, enabling us to move and think. Unfortunately, when brain cells are damaged by trauma or disease they don’t automatically regenerate
